Problem statement
Ensure most recent interop features are fully documented on MDN
Proposed solutions
Ensure all documentation for interop features exist, updating content that already exists for Baseline, support lingo, removing unnecessary fallback information, linking to related content, and creating new content (guides mostly) if missing.
Task list
For each topic above, do the following:
Priority assessment
These topics were all considered important enough to be included in last year's interop. They have all been addressed in 2023 and should be fully supported in all browsers and fully covered in MDN docs. We need to confirm that they are covered, that guides exist and are useful, and the content is accurate and well linked, while ensuring new feature coverage is relevant to developer needs, discusses accessibility and best practices, and doesn't promote new features over more mundane legacy features.
